> Basically:
> Before this option, all Object literals and Object access were being
> renamed by the Google Closure compiler. This caused untyped object
> references to be very fragile and tend to break when the code is minimized.
>
> This option changes all unknown references to quoted references. This
> means object literals will have property names quoted (i.e.
> {“name”:”Harbs”} instead of {name:”Harbs”} and foo[“name”] instead of
> foo.name. This is the recommended practice by Google when renaming
> properties might have unwanted consequences.
> https://developers.google.com/closure/compiler/docs/api-tutorial3 <
> https://developers.google.com/closure/compiler/docs/api-tutorial3>
>
> The downside of this change is that Objects might be minimized less than
> without this option. But it’s much safer. Another downside is that it
> encourages users to use Object.
>
> I spent many hours quoting object literals due to minimizing bugs. I
> expect this to be a pain point for lots of others too.

> >>> compiler-jx: added js-dynamic-access-unknown-members compiler option
> >> to have emitter use dynamic bracket access when the right side of a
> member
> >> access expression cannot be resolved to a definition.
> >>>
> >>> In other words, myObj.dynamicMember will become
> >> myObj['dynamicMember']. Known members will use the regular dot syntax.
> >> Useful for stopping the Closure compiler from renaming members that are
> >> dynamic, such as members of an object literal. Defaults to false to
> avoid
> >> breaking anything. However, I think it makes sense to have it default to
> >> true instead to give developers a better user experience.
